Title: The Innovative Mind of Anders Khullar

Introduction

Anders Khullar is a prominent inventor based in Bjärred, Sweden. He holds an impressive portfolio of 16 patents, showcasing his contributions to the field of biometric authentication and communication technologies. His work has significantly impacted the way devices interact and authenticate users.

Latest Patents

Among his latest patents, one notable invention is related to biometric template handling. This method involves acquiring biometric data from a prospective user and utilizing a decryption key from an external device to authenticate the user. The process includes retrieving and decrypting an encrypted biometric template to compare it with the acquired biometric data for authentication purposes. Another significant patent focuses on a communication arrangement that facilitates wired communication between an electronic host device and an electrical slave device, such as a smartphone and a smart card during an enrollment process. This invention also provides a method for guiding users through the enrollment process.
